Why did I receive a text message from 95566 Bank of China today saying that I was applying for a credit card, but I didn’t apply at all?

1. It may be that someone else’s number is very similar to yours, and they were given the wrong number, or the bank staff entered the wrong number. It is possible. It is best to call and ask. They put.

2. It may be that someone else is using your information to apply for a card. Quickly call 95566 to apply successfully. If the application is successful, take it with you immediately

It is a credit card fraud. It refers to the behavior of using counterfeiters to impersonate other people's credit cards for the purpose of illegal possession, or using credit cards to maliciously overdraft, defrauding public and private property, and the amount is relatively large. The protected interests in this crime are public and private property ownership, bank financial management systems, and commercial operation management systems.

The legal basis is (1) the relevant provisions of the "Criminal Law of the People's Republic of China": Article 196 Under one of the following circumstances, credit card fraud activities are carried out, and the amount is relatively large. , shall be sentenced to imprisonment or criminal detention for not more than five years, and shall also be fined not less than 20,000 yuan but not more than 200,000 yuan; if the amount is huge, the sentence shall be not less than five years but not more than 10 years, but also to a fine of not less than 50,000 yuan but not more than 500,000 yuan. A fine of not more than 10,000 yuan; if the amount is particularly huge or there are other particularly serious circumstances, the sentence shall be not less than 10 years or more and a fine of not less than 50,000 yuan but not more than 500,000 yuan, or property confiscation:

(1) Using a forged credit card, or using a credit card fraudulently obtained with false identification;
